CONCACAF teams are in preparations for this year’s Futsal Championship which will also qualify four nations to the FIFA Futsal World Cup Thailand 2012. Here is a look at what they are doing.


COSTA RICA WINS PAIR OF FRIENDLIES AGAINST MEXICO

Costa Rica won a pair of friendlies against visiting Mexico by outscoring them 10:0. Jorge Arias, Alejandro Paniaqua, Yefrid Ruiz along with an own goal from Mexico’s Giovani Lopez gave the Ticos a 4:0 victory in the first encounter at Heredia’s Palacio de los Deportes on 29 February. Two days later (2 March) at the Gimnasio Nacional in San José, Edwin Cubillo scored twice, while Arias, Erick Brenes, Jose Guevara and Paniagua each added a goal apiece in the 6:0 triumph for Costa Rica in its seventh consecutive win over Mexico.


GUATEMALA TAKES TWO FROM MOZAMBIQUE
In its second-ever trip to Africa, defending CONCACAF champion Guatemala won both friendlies against the host Mozambique at Maputo’s Pavilhao da Academica on 25 and 26 February. Two goals each from Jose Carlos Mansilla and Rafael Gonzalez led the Chapines to a 6:1 victory in the first encounter, while the second match ended 2:1 in favor of the visitors.
